Java web服务生产者和消费者之间的区别是什么?

Java web服务生产者和消费者之间的区别是什么?,java,web-services,Java,Web Services,我习惯于web服务中的术语客户机和服务(或服务器) 请确认哪一个是web服务生产者和消费者 你能告诉我为什么两个词有相同的意思吗?我不明白我的同事们抱怨客户机/服务器这一术语会引起混淆 谢谢。客户=>消费者:客户就是消费的人 Server=>Producer:为客户机制作东西的人 客户机/服务器通常用于体系结构概念中,因此它不描述WS本身,而是描述连接的对象和连接的对象之间的体系结构模式。 消费者/生产者更容易理解,因为它描述了服务架构模式。你有一部分人提供服务,另一部分人使用服务 因此,客户机

我习惯于web服务中的术语客户机服务(或服务器)

请确认哪一个是web服务生产者消费者

你能告诉我为什么两个词有相同的意思吗?我不明白我的同事们抱怨客户机/服务器这一术语会引起混淆


谢谢。

客户=>消费者:客户就是消费的人

Server=>Producer:为客户机制作东西的人

客户机/服务器通常用于体系结构概念中,因此它不描述WS本身,而是描述连接的对象和连接的对象之间的体系结构模式。 消费者/生产者更容易理解,因为它描述了服务架构模式。你有一部分人提供服务,另一部分人使用服务


因此,客户机/服务器更通用。消费者/生产者是特定于SOA的。

即使这个问题与主题无关

你应该知道:

客户端=>消费者:当它使用服务时

服务器=>生产者:为消费者生成服务数据时

我们有两个词,一个表示天真,一个表示技术用户

希望我的回答能让你明白


非常感谢,

远程portlet Web服务(WSRP)
介绍了和的概念。通过使用WSRP,您可以通过将符合WSRP的生产者作为消费者集成到WebLogic Portal中来聚合应用程序功能。因此,您的最终用户将能够与消费者交互以查看集成的应用程序

图.生产者和消费者之间的Web服务


有关更多详细信息,请参见链接。

您能为naive和其他技术用户明确说明一个吗?@Julia我认为他错了。这不是天真的,而是更一般的。参考我的答案版本。谢谢你们两位的答案+1。所以如果你有一个wsdl链接,你想获得数据。你在消费,对吗?谢谢你的回答+1.